Has a College Football game ever ended 72-3?

It has. 72-3 has been a College Football final 2 times in 84,433 games. The first was California beat Washington on November 12, 1921; the latest was Oklahoma beat Utah State on September 28, 1974.

That makes 72-3 the 1611th most common final score out of 2,216 that have ever occurred in College Football. One point away, 73-3 has happened 5 times and 72-4 has happened 1 times. At one point the score disappeared for 53 years, between 1921 and 1974.
